The Role

As Clearpay continues to scale, our Relationship Management team plays an increasingly critical role in driving sustainable growth across our largest and most strategic merchants. We are seeking a senior, highly commercial relationship manager to own and grow a portfolio of key enterprise merchants in the UK, spanning both new and existing partnerships. This role will be instrumental in shaping Clearpay’s enterprise engagement strategy, acting as a trusted advisor to senior merchant stakeholders and a key voice internally to influence product, commercial, and operational outcomes. This role reports to the Head of Relationship Management and can be based remotely in the UK.

You Will

  • Own and grow long-term, strategic enterprise partnerships that deliver material value for Merchants, Customers, and Clearpay, with accountability across topline growth, profitability, and unit economics.
  • Define and execute bespoke growth strategies for enterprise merchants, driving increased adoption, performance, and revenue across existing contracts and newly launched partnerships.
  • Lead complex Merchant 'Go Lives' and expansions, acting as the senior point of coordination across Sales, Marketing, Product, Legal, Risk, and Operations to ensure successful delivery.
  • Build trusted relationships with senior merchant stakeholders, positioning Clearpay as a strategic partner and advisor rather than a transactional provider.
  • Shape, evolve, and champion Clearpay’s enterprise Merchant Value Proposition across the full lifecycle, ensuring world-class engagement and long-term retention.
  • Identify strategic opportunities, risks, and market insights from enterprise merchants, feeding these into senior leadership to inform product roadmap, commercial strategy, and operational improvements.
  • Drive best practices and scalable improvements across the relationship management function, mentoring junior team members and contributing to capability uplift across the wider team.

You Have

  • 5+ years experience managing and growing enterprise-level merchants within e-commerce, payments, fintech, or retail environments.
  • Proven track record of owning complex, high-value client relationships with accountability for commercial outcomes.
  • Experience operating in a high-growth or rapidly scaling technology business.
  • Strong commercial acumen, with the ability to balance revenue growth, customer outcomes, and profitability.
  • Confidence engaging with senior and C-suite merchant stakeholders, influencing decision-making and navigating complex organisations.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ional initiatives and drive outcomes without direct authority.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to clearly articulate strategy and value.
  • Highly organised, able to manage multiple enterprise accounts and initiatives simultaneously.
  • A proactive, self-driven leader with a strong sense of ownership and accountability.
  • Passion for building exceptional, long-term customer partnerships and raising the bar for enterprise relationship management.
